Last year we ran AI tools through real service businesses—a dental practice, a plumbing company, a personal training studio. Most small business owners we talk to buy marketing automation software because of marketing hype, not because they actually need to automate a $5,000/month marketing operation. So we committed: only recommend tools where we see 3:1 ROI or faster payback than 6 months. Here are the five that cleared that bar.
HubSpot Free and Pro Tier: Lead Capture to Email Automation
HubSpot's free tier handles lead forms, email workflows, and contact management with zero cost. We use it for clients with under 1,000 leads per month. A plumbing company we worked with set up a form offering a 'Free Plumbing Diagnostic' on their website. HubSpot auto-enrolled captures into an 8-email nurture sequence over 30 days. Result: 28% of form-fills became phone calls within 10 days. Cost: $0. Time to setup: 6 hours. The Pro tier ($45/month) adds email A/B testing and lead scoring—worth it if you're sending more than 500 emails/month.
- Free: lead forms, basic automation, email sequences, contact database
- Pro ($45/month): A/B testing, lead scoring, advanced workflows, contact insights
- Use case: Service businesses with 10–50 monthly leads
- Setup time: 4–8 hours (including form and email creation)
ChatGPT + Zapier: Content and Messaging Automation on Budget
You don't need an AI 'marketing platform'—you need ChatGPT ($20/month for Plus) + Zapier ($25/month). A dental practice we consulted used this combo to draft patient educational emails, blog post outlines, and Google review responses. ChatGPT generates 80% of the copy; the dentist reviews and personalizes 20%. Each email takes 3 minutes instead of 15. Over a month, that's 4+ hours recovered per staff member. Zapier automates the trigger: when a patient books an appointment, a Zapier rule fires a welcome email 24 hours before their visit. No API knowledge required.
ChatGPT Plus is $20/month. Zapier is $25–100/month depending on automation volume. A personal training studio automated their 'post-workout survey' email with Zapier—triggered the day after each session. They captured feedback on 67% more workouts and improved NPS from 34 to 52 within 12 weeks.

Mailchimp: Email Segmentation and Behavioral Automation
Mailchimp's free tier handles up to 500 contacts and basic automations. The Pro tier ($20/month) adds behavioral triggers—send an email when a contact clicks a link, opens a prior email, or hasn't engaged in 60 days. A fitness studio we worked with segments their email list into 'Active Members,' 'At-Risk Members,' and 'Former Members.' At-risk members (those who haven't attended in 21 days) get a re-engagement campaign offering a free small-group class. Result: 31% of at-risk members returned within 45 days. Cost: $20/month + 2 hours of monthly list maintenance.
- Free: up to 500 contacts, basic email campaigns, no automations
- Pro ($20/month): behavioral automations, segmentation, A/B testing
- Use case: Service businesses managing 100–2,000 customer emails
- Payback: 4–6 months for retention-focused studios and practices
Google Analytics 4 + Looker Studio: Automated Dashboards and Reports
GA4 is free. Looker Studio (Google Data Studio) is free. Combined, they give you automated marketing reporting without hiring a data analyst. We set up a Looker dashboard for a property management company that updates daily—showing website traffic, form submissions, call conversions, and cost-per-lead. The manager checks it every Monday. Instead of manually pulling reports for 2 hours, the information is live and waiting. GA4's automated events capture form submissions, phone calls, and chat starts without custom code if you set up Google Tag Manager.
Setup takes 6–12 hours but saves 8–10 hours monthly on reporting. That's 96–120 hours per year—real time back in your business.
Calendly + Zapier: Appointment Booking and Follow-up Automation
Calendly's free tier lets customers book appointments without email chains. When booked, Zapier fires a confirmation text, adds the contact to a Mailchimp list, and creates a calendar reminder for your team. A coaching practice used this to cut 'no-shows' from 18% to 6% by sending an SMS reminder 24 hours before appointments. Calendly Pro is $12/month. Zapier integration is covered in your existing subscription. Total monthly cost: $12. New revenue from reduced no-shows: estimated $340–500/month for a practice seeing 40 clients weekly.
- Calendly free: basic booking, email confirmations
- Calendly Pro ($12/month): unlimited calendar connections, SMS reminders, no-show fees
- Pair with Zapier to send SMS reminders and post-appointment surveys automatically
- ROI: Reduce no-shows by 50–70% and capture post-appointment feedback at scale
